Misa-chan 3rd February 2012 02:36 AM

^^ It is probably illegal to scalp, but I always see lots of them at the Yoyogi venue, so maybe noone really cares much? But it'll be best if you get a Japanese friend to buy the ticket from the scalper instead of doing it yourself, since they may jack up the price because you're a foreigner and they know you need a ticket cause that's what you came to Japan for (to see ayu) lol. :laugh

So yeah, it's possible to get really good deals from scalpers, but just be careful! :)

tokyoxjapanxfan 12th February 2012 12:13 PM

^ it's completely random. and yes you don't know your seat until you print out your tickets.

It's just a guaranteed ticket at list price. For RnRC first day, I had the -worst- seats ever. I was completely to the side, almost parallel to the stage, and so I couldn't see anything happening. I had to look at the screens the whole time, unless she was on the runway.

If you want a great ticket, it's almost necessary to go to a ticket shop. However you have to be willing to pay the price.

I am not willing to pay more than list price especially since I see her often (2-3 times a tour, plus a-nation), so I rely on TA.
